2. Actions to Obtain a Driving License
The procedure of acquiring a driving license in Poland consists of numerous steps:
Step 1: Eligibility Verification
- Age Requirement: Ensure that you satisfy the minimum age requirement for your desired category.
- Health Examination: Undergo a medical evaluation that verifies your physical fitness to drive.
Step 2: Enroll in a Driving School
Discover an accredited driving school and register for a course that matches your requirements. The driving school will offer both theoretical knowledge and practical driving lessons.
Step 3: Theoretical Examination
Pass the theoretical exam, which covers traffic guidelines, policies, and security. This test can be taken in multiple languages, including English.
Step 4: Practical Examination
As soon as you pass the theoretical test, schedule and take the practical driving test. This test assesses your driving skills in real-world scenarios.
Step 5: Application Submission
Submit your application for a driving license at your local municipal workplace (Urząd Miasta) or Provincial Road Traffic Centre (Wydział Komunikacji). You will need to present:
- Theoretical and useful assessment certificates
- Medical certificate
- Completed application form
- Identity documents
- Photos
Action 6: Payment of Fees
Pay the needed fees, which can differ depending on your place and license classification. The approximate cost breakdown is as follows:
| Item | Cost (PLN) |
|---|---|
| Medical Examination | 200 |
| Driving Course | 1,500 - 3,500 |
| Theoretical Examination Fee | 50 |
| Practical Examination Fee | 200 |
| License Issuance Fee | 100 |
Upon effective application, you will get your driving license in the mail, which normally takes about 2-3 weeks.
3. The Delivery Process
The delivery process of the driving license in Poland can be broken down into the following steps:
- Application Processing: Once the application is submitted, regional authorities will process it and may contact you for additional information.
- License Creation: After approval, your license will be produced. This consists of features like biometric data to guarantee security and authenticity.
- Dispatch: The settled driving license is sent out to the address offered in your application through postal services. It's important to make sure that this address is existing to prevent delivery problems.
- Tracking: In some regions, applicants can track the status of their license delivery by means of online platforms provided by the local authorities.
